WebTo achieve a small area for clock distribution, the multi-phase clock generator reported here uses the delay compensation technique. Because this generator does not require a feedback loop, it is compact, adding only a small amount to chip area. Further, it produces accurate phase differences between multi-phase clock signals.

Most integrated circuits (ICs) of sufficient complexity use a clock signal in order to synchronize different parts of the circuit, cycling at a rate slower than the worst-case internal propagation delays. In some cases, more than one clock cycle is required to perform a predictable action. As ICs become more complex, the problem of supplying accurate and synchronized clocks to all the circuits becomes increasingly difficult.
